  1. In Jamf Pro, click Settings in the sidebar.
  2. In the Global section, click Apple education support .
  3. Click Edit .
  4. If you have not enabled Apple education support, select the Enable Apple education support checkbox.
  5. Select the Enable User Images checkbox.
  6. Enter a distribution point URL for user images.
    Important:

    Editing the distribution point URL for user images causes existing EDU profiles to be redistributed. This can increase network traffic.

  7. If you have not already downloaded the CA certificate (.pem), click Download to download the certificate, and then save the certificate in the appropriate location dictated by your web server vendor.
  8. (Optional) If your web server uses a self-signed certificate or a certificate signed by an internal CA, you must upload an additional certificate (.p12 or .pem) from your web server to the Jamf Pro server to establish trust between the Jamf Pro server and the web server hosting the user images.
  9. Click Save .
  10. (Optional) Use the Test button to ensure that the user images on your distribution point are accessible.

Due to caching, user images may not appear immediately on devices. You may need to restart the device or the Classroom app for user images to appear.
